  21. In my experience, most "simple" reps (IE- Submariners, SFSO) are somewhat safe in this regard... I generally (bare minimum) make sure the caseback is tightened but once I have time I grease the caseback and thread gaskets if present (Rolex for example). I've taken my SFSO and SSD diving with no issues at all (not always recommended ... you never know if the HE valve is faulty, etc - I had them pressure checked) so in my opinion (far from expert) I'd say most anything with a screwdown crown and secure caseback should be fine for domestic stuff / a shower... best thing to do is have the WR checked by a professional.
